Subject: DR drill results — Kitplane component library

Hi — summarizing Tuesday's disaster-recovery drill for your review. We simulated a total loss of the registry hosting Kitplane, our shared component library. Restoring versions 4.x from cold storage worked, but the semver metadata index had to be rebuilt by hand, which took ninety minutes. We've filed follow-ups to automate that. To validate the restored signing chain yourself, open the verification tool and authenticate with the drill recovery passphrase included below.

strongbox words: oliath-framir

// The Tollgate payments integration tests were flaky for
// months because we polled the ledger-sync endpoint too fast
// and caught it mid-settlement. Marek bumped this constant to
// 1500ms and the flakes basically vanished. Yes, it makes the
// suite slower. No, we don't care — a green build beats a fast
// red one. If you change it, run the full suite ten times.
// The build where we validated the fix is noted below.
// ----------------------------------------------------------

pipeline stamp: htk9_6ce9d33c5

Ticket: Night-shift access — Support Team, Darnell House.

Requested by: Support lead, Corvessa desk.
Need: Out-of-hours entry for six support staff, Sunday–Thursday, 22:00–06:00, Level 1 only.
Badges already issued; access group updated tonight. Side entrance only; main lobby locked after 21:00. Report faults to facilities desk next morning. Use the temporary door code below.

badge for hawip-taweg: bdg-QFZSW-38965

Before any Pathwren mobile release: verify the route manifest version matches the backend config, or stale links will 404 in-app. Run the link smoke suite against both staging universal links and the legacy scheme. Breaking a registered route requires a two-version deprecation window — no exceptions. If routes changed this release, confirm the fallback web handler was redeployed first. Rollback means reverting the manifest, not the binary. The full route registry and sign-off checklist live on the release page.

dashboard of bafof-hafog = https://confluence.lumiclabs.internal/display/browse/display/6a09a20a